The most widely researched family members of molecules in recent years from the context of neuroinflammation could be the family members of ALIAmides, autacoid neighborhood damage antagonist amides. The term autacoids refers to endogenous compounds or perhaps the precursors or other derivatives thereof, They may be produced on ask for, after which you can metabolized in precisely the same cells and/or tissues [ninety four]. Since autacoids are endogenous molecules, they provide quite a few Rewards over the therapy with common medication. Mostly, metabolic pathways are intrinsic for the tissue and this means no creation of toxic metabolites. Furthermore, classical medications give attention to blocking one concentrate on receptor only, which produce a unexpected halt of the physiological method and produce collateral injury. On the contrary, instead modern day autacoid drugs appears at endogenous compounds or their derivatives, which use physiological pathways to modify pathological procedures, And so the chance of Unintended effects is lower [ninety five,ninety six]. In 1993, the Nobel laureate Rita Levi-Montalcini coined the phrase “aliamides” for these kinds of compounds [97]; they characterize a small host of naturally transpiring N-acyl ethanolamines (NAEs) which are specifically enriched in animal tissues [ninety eight].

The lower in progesterone straight away prior to menstruation causes a release of fatty acids together with arachidonic acid from uterine cells as well as the manufacture of mediators such as prostaglandin F2α (PGF2α) and prostaglandin E2 (PGE2), which cause myometrial contraction and vasoconstriction, resulting in community ischemia and pain [a hundred forty five]. The menstrual fluid of girls with dysmenorrhea has greater amounts of these prostaglandins than that of eumenorrheic women [seventy three], having a direct correlation among severity of dysmenorrheic signs and prostaglandin ranges. These are typically best in the to start with two times of menstruation, which coincides Together with the period of finest pain.

Long-term pain is An important source of morbidity for which you will discover restricted effective treatment options. Palmitoylethanolamide (PEA), a In a natural way happening fatty acid amide, has shown utility while in the procedure of neuropathic and inflammatory agony. Rising reviews have supported a attainable part for its use during the therapy of Long-term agony, While this continues to be controversial. We undertook a systematic review and meta-Assessment to look at the efficacy of PEA as an analgesic agent for chronic soreness. A scientific literature lookup was done, using the databases MEDLINE and Web of Science, to establish double-blind randomized controlled trials comparing PEA to placebo or Lively comparators while in the remedy of Long-term ache.

When taken by mouth: PEA is maybe Harmless when useful for approximately three months. It's always properly tolerated but might result in nausea in some individuals. There's not adequate responsible details to know if PEA is safe to work with for lengthier than 3 months.
